In 2024, Lithuania continued to see significant import shipments of train lighting primarily from Poland, Finland, Latvia, Germany, and China. The high Herfindahl-Hirschman Index (HHI) indicates a concentrated market structure. Despite a modest compound annual growth rate (CAGR) of 0.21% from 2020 to 2024, there was a slight decline in the growth rate from 2023 to 2024 at -5.93%. This data suggests a stable but slightly declining trend in the import of train lighting products into Lithuania, emphasizing the importance of monitoring market dynamics for industry players.

The Lithuania Train Lighting Market is experiencing steady growth driven by the increasing demand for energy-efficient lighting solutions in the transportation sector. LED technology is gaining traction in the market due to its long lifespan, lower energy consumption, and cost-effectiveness. Railway companies in Lithuania are investing in upgrading their lighting systems to enhance passenger experience, improve safety, and reduce operating costs. Government regulations promoting sustainability and energy efficiency also play a significant role in shaping the market dynamics. Key players in the Lithuania Train Lighting Market include major lighting manufacturers, technology providers, and railway operators offering a range of products such as LED lighting fixtures, control systems, and maintenance services to meet the evolving needs of the industry.

The Lithuanian government has implemented policies to promote energy efficiency and sustainability in the train lighting market. In line with the European Union directives, Lithuania has set targets to reduce energy consumption and greenhouse gas emissions in the transportation sector, including trains. The government encourages the use of energy-efficient lighting technologies such as LED lights in trains to minimize energy consumption and lower operational costs. Additionally, there are regulations in place to ensure the safety and quality standards of train lighting systems, aiming to enhance passenger experience and overall safety during train journeys. Overall, the government`s policies focus on promoting environmentally friendly and cost-effective lighting solutions in the Lithuania train market.
